This study presents the development of a Web-Based Leave Management System (WBLMS) designed for the Human Resource Management Office (HRMO) of the Local Government Unit (LGU) of Balingasag to address inefficiencies in the existing paper-based leave process. The manual system caused delays, inaccurate record-keeping, and difficulty in accessing and verifying employee leave data. Using the Waterfall Software Development Life Cycle (SDLC) model, the study systematically followed the stages of requirement analysis, system design, development, testing, deployment, and maintenance. The system was developed using PHP, MySQL, HTML, CSS, and JavaScript to ensure functionality, security, and accessibility. Key features include online leave application and approval, real-time tracking of leave balances and credits, and automated reporting tools for HR administrators. The results demonstrate that the system successfully streamlined leave management operations, reduced human error, and improved transparency and accessibility for both employees and HR personnel. The study concludes that the implementation of a web-based solution enhances operational efficiency, strengthens data security, and supports digital transformation in local government administration.
